The German musician, composer and producer is responsible for the following Eurovision-entries:

1974: Bye, Bye I Love You - Ireen Sheer (Luxembourg, 4th place)
1976: Sing Sang Song - Les Humphries Singers (Germany, 15th place)
1979: Dschinghis Khan - Dschinghis Khan (Germany, 4th place)
1980: Theater - Katja Ebstein (Germany, 2nd place)
1980: Papa Pingouin - Sophie & Magaly (Luxembourg, 9th place)
1981: Johnny Blue - Lena Valaitis (Germany, 2nd place)
1982: Ein Bißchen Frieden - Nicole (Germany, 1st place)
1985: Children, Kinder, Enfants - Ireen Sheer, C. & M. Roberts, Olivier, Solomon (Luxembourg, 13th place)
1987: Laß die Sonne in Dein Herz - Wind (Germany, 2nd place)
1988: Lied für einen Freund - Maxi & Chris Garden (Germany, 14th place)
1990: Frei zu leben - Chris Kempers & Daniel Kovac (Germany, 9th place)
1992: Träume sind für alle da - Wind (Germany, 16th place)
1994: Wir geben 'ne Party - MeKaDo (Germany, 3rd place)
1997: Zeit - Bianca Shomburg (Germany, 18th place)
1999: Reise nach Jerusalem - Sürpriz (Germany, 3rd place)
2002: I Can't Live Without Music - Corinna May (Germany, 21st place)
2003: Let's Get Happy - Lou (Germany, 11th place)
2006: If We All Give A Little - six4one (Switzerland, 17th place)
2009: Just Get Out of My Life - Andrea Demirović (Montenegro, 11th place in the semi-final)
